Great Leap
Great Leap's summer menu was recently released with the theme “summer just got fresher,” adding some healthier, fresh dishes and ingredients into the mix. One of those "healthier" dishes is the Avocado Burger (RMB 65), which sees sliced avocado paired with melted cheese and a beef patty sandwiched inside one of their butter-toasted buns, all served with a side of their signature fries. Perhaps it's still not the healthiest option, but hey, with that avocado at least you're getting one of your five daily servings of fruits and veggies!

Jing-A
Last week, Jing-A launched a special Watermelon Set Meal (RMB 299), which includes the Caramel Watermelon Burger. This creative offering layers grilled caramelized watermelon with a beef patty, then tops it with tangy pickles for a refreshing kick – a perfect burger for summer that is sure to be a hit with those who enjoy the sweetness of a Hawaiian burger. The set meal also includes Spicy-Sweet Fruit Salad and Creamy Yunnan-Guizhou Sour Fish, plus two watermelon-based beers, the Beijing Bikini 11.0 and Watermelon Cool. The set meal is available at all Jing-A locations until Jul 25.

WhyNot
WhyNot will soon be adding the two limited-edition burgers they made for the last Juicy Burger Fest to their menu. The first is the Summer Break, a burger inspired by the Wuhan snack 炸藕海 zhà ǒu hǎi (lotus root fritter) that sees Angus beef patties laid on a bed of crispy lotus root chips then topped with Cheddar cheese and fried river shrimp all in a soft brioche bun. The other is the Jindou Cloud (Cheesy Beef Burger), which features a premium Angus beef patty smothered in a thick layer of cream cheese, all nestled within a buttery brioche bun for a gooey, cloud-like delight.

Q MEX
Cheese fans, rejoice! Q MEX has just revamped their whole menu, and they've put their Cheese Fondue Burger (RMB 95) back on the menu. Two Australian Angus beef patties, double cheese, jalapeños, mayonnaise, and special burger sauce are sandwiched in a burger bun then cut in half and served in a pool of sizzling jalapeño cheese sauce, bacon bits and pico de gallo.

Beersmith
Following a menu update, Beersmith has added two new burgers to their menu. The first is the Blue Duke Burger (RMB 98), which debuted at Juicy Burger Fest and piles blue cheese, honey mayo and pickled onions on a beef patty for one honking burger that cheese fans will love. The other new burger is the Spicy Queen Burger (RMB 98), which features an Angus beef patty, bacon, cheese, hot sauce and a slice of grilled pineapple.
